The truth of the end of suffering Nirodha The Truth of the End of Suffering (Nirodha): Path to Liberation 🌸 The Third Noble Truth in Buddhism is Nirodha , or "The Truth of the End of Suffering." This truth offers us hope, freedom, and liberation from the ongoing cycle of suffering (dukkha) . Unlike many belief systems that focus solely on the nature of suffering, Buddhism gives us a way out—a path toward enduring peace and freedom . The essence of Nirodha is that suffering can end and that we can transcend the cycle of craving , attachment , and ignorance . 1. What Does Nirodha Mean? The word Nirodha means cessation or ending . In the context of the Third Noble Truth, it refers to the cessation of suffering and the extinguishing of its causes —primarily craving (tanha) and ignorance (avijja).
